    <description>The Court set aside the order dated 24.09.2018 under Section 84 of the TNVAT Act, 2006, due to a violation of natural justice for not granting a proper opportunity for a personal hearing. The matter was remitted back to the respondent for a fresh order, emphasizing the need for a written opportunity for a personal hearing. The Court refrained from expressing any opinion on the assessment&#039;s merits, leaving it to the respondent to issue a new order within four weeks, with no costs imposed.</description>
